Product Description

Product Description

First came THE UNSEEN UNIVERSITY CHALLENGE, the Discworld Quizbook that left a trail of exploded minds from London to Ankh-Morpork. now THE WYRDEST LINK takes trivia to strange new heights, with hundreds more Discworld posers, questions iin the merciless tradition of the Star Chamber, the Spanish Inquisition and Anne Robinson . . . So is it a good thing or a bad thing to be THE WYRDEST LINK?

About the Author

David Langford has been intimately involved in the Discworld from the time THE COLOUR OF MAGIC, the first Discworld novel, was published. It is rumoured, in some quarters, that he knows even more about the Discworld and the strange denizens that people this marvellous world than the Creator himself.

From the librarian's scarily realistic Anne Robinson wink to the probing interrogation-type question style, I found this book a lot more taxing than David Langford's earlier offerring 'The Unseen University Challenge'. The more challenging questions make the book very hard to put down, and even harder to 'step away from'. This is definately a read for all those who consider themselves to be experts on Mr Pratchett's multiverse. It's a good idea to have a Discworld reference library at hand! When you've read it you will easily be able to list the different varieties of swamp dragon and quote from Humbert Wolfe's forgotten 1930 verse novel 'The Uncelestial City'. If you were not already one, this book will turn you into a true Discworld Swat!

Those of you who are fans of Terry Pratchett will appreciate this trivia book. If you thought you knew something about the plots and puns of Discworld, and those of the Roundworld, as well, try your hand at these stumpers. It's a small book, divided into sections, with ten trivia questions persection. Answers are at the back of the book, but there's a hook--BONUS questions included in the answers!

I have read everything of Pratchett's I can get my hands on--several times. Thought I knew a lot about the Discworld and the inhabitants. NAH! Just a beginner.

It's a lot of fun, a lot of completely useless knowledge, and you can read it in public, if you put a plain brown wrapper on the cover.
